On Thu, 04 Nov 1999 23:05:30 +0100, Jos Backus wrote:

> This patch adds a ``-x'' flag to ftpd, which instructs ftpd to obtain
> an exclusive lock on files it commits to disk as a result of a store
> operation.  This way it becomes easy to tell whether a download has
> finished, in case the file needs to be copied someplace else (as in my
> case).

So fstat(1) doesn't show you that the file is opened to ftpd? You really
have to lock the files to help you with this problem?
